Drumming & Relaxation

UPDATED 20150805 16:44:06

Each class will include gentle exercises to relax, stretch, energise and strengthen. Some are adapted from yoga or tai chi. There will be practice of relaxation and meditation exercises based on counting breaths. Then there will be learning activities to develop drum/percussion playing skills including Drumcircle (create your own) and some Samba rhythms.
